我使用一些MSBuild参数创建了一个构建定义(/ target:Publish / property:PublishDir = \ mypc \ tmp \ /property:ApplicationVersion=1.0.0.1)
自动为每个构建增加ApplicationVersion的最佳方法是什么?
答案 0 :(得分:4)
首先,我建议您确保解决方案中的所有项目都使用共享的AssemblyInfo文件(如上所述here)。
然后更改构建脚本,以便签出文件,增加并保存版本号,然后再次签入。
要做到这一点,请查看community build tasks或create your own。